电脑编程必备工具一览代码编辑器与集成开发环境总结掌握这些工具你的编程之路会更加顺畅

电脑编程必备工具一览

电脑编程就像盖房子,需要各种工具来帮忙。下面就是一些主要的工具,它们就像你的得力助手,让你的编程工作更轻松。

一、代码编辑器与集成开发环境(IDE)

编程的第一步是写代码,这就需要用到代码编辑器或者IDE。比如Sublime Text和Visual Studio Code,它们不仅能让你写出漂亮的代码,还能帮你调试和版本控制。

工具 功能
Sublime Text 语法高亮、代码折叠
Visual Studio Code 集成调试、版本控制

二、编译器与解释器

写完代码,就需要编译器或解释器来让它跑起来。编译器把代码变成电脑能理解的机器码,而解释器则是边读边执行。这取决于你用的编程语言。

编程语言 工具
C/C++ 编译链接生成可执行文件
Python、JavaScript 解释执行

三、版本控制系统

编程是个团队活,版本控制系统就像一个仓库,帮你管理代码的各个版本,还能多人协作。

常用的有Git和SVN,它们让你的代码回溯和分支管理变得简单。

四、调试工具

代码出错了别担心,调试工具能帮你找到并修复它们。很多IDE自带调试工具,还能提供断点设置、单步执行等功能。

五、构建工具

构建工具帮你自动化编译、链接、打包等过程,让从代码到程序的过程更顺畅。

比如Make、Apache Maven和Gradle,它们让构建过程更高效。

六、测试框架

保证代码质量也很重要,测试框架能自动执行测试用例,帮你发现代码缺陷。

JUnit、TestNG适合Java,pytest适合Python。

总结

掌握这些工具,你的编程之路会更加顺畅。选择合适的工具,就像找到一把好用的锤子,能让你更快地完成工作。

FAQs

以下是一些常见问题,帮你更好地了解这些工具:

1. 电脑编程需要什么工具?

电脑编程需要文本编辑器、IDE、版本控制系统、调试器、浏览器开发工具和文档资料等工具的支持。

2. 我需要什么类型的软件来进行编程?

根据你的编程需求选择适当类型的软件,比如文本编辑器、IDE、数据分析软件、游戏开发引擎等。

3. 作为初学者,我需要哪些工具来学习编程?

初学者可以尝试编译器、在线学习平台、练习编码网站、社区和论坛、参考文档和书籍等工具。